Interacting Minds: Gaze Synchronization and Representational Change in Dialogue
Abstract
We know that communicating with others can lead to mutual adaptations in the signals adopted. It is less clear whether and how interlocutors converge in their cognitive representations of communicative referents. By tracking eye movements during dialogue and probing interlocutors' representations of a set of referents before and after interaction, we captured the interactional dynamics underpinning mutual representational adaptations. In this exploratory study focused on attention, we investigated the relationship between dyads' gaze dynamics during a communication game, the Tangram task, and interaction-related changes in their representation of a set of referents, measured using explicit and implicit similarity probes. A cross-recurrence analysis of participants' gaze showed, in replication of Dale, Kirkham, and Richardson (2011), that interlocutors' gaze became increasingly synchronized as the task progressed. We further operationalized events of mutual understanding using gaze coherence and investigated the semantic and pupillary dynamics leading to these moments of mutual understanding.
